The AXFA14 magnetic flow meter remote converter is a sophisticated product with outstanding reliability and ease of operation, developed on the basis of decades of fieldproven experience.

The AXFA14 employs an LCD indicator, infra-red switches, and "Easy Setup" parameters to ensure substantially improved ease of maintenance. The combination of a replaceable electrode type flowtube and diagnostics to detect the adhesion level on the electrodes dramatically improves maintainability. The AXFA14 also employs the fluid noise free "Dual Frequency Excitation Method" and the newly added "Enhanced Dual Frequency Excitation Method" as an option for more difficult applications to ensure greater stability and quicker response.
